1. 首页
  2. 交易所费率对比
  3. 正文

介绍挖矿之谜,背后算法究竟计算什么?

《介绍挖矿之谜:背后算法究竟计算什么?》

介绍挖矿之谜,背后算法究竟计算什么?

的狂潮中,挖矿成为了一个神秘而诱人的词汇。无数人投身试图揭开这层神秘的面纱。那么,挖矿究竟是什么算法?它背后的计算究竟解决什么问题?本文将带你走进挖矿的世界,一竟。

一、挖矿的定义

挖矿,即计算机硬件进行加密货币的生成过程。比特币加密货币的体系中,挖矿是获得新币的初露途径。简单,挖矿是计算机硬件对加密货币的算法进行大量计算,以解决复杂的数学问题。

二、挖矿的算法

1、 比特币算法

比特币采用SHA-256算法,这是一种广泛应用于密码学中的散列函数。比特币体系中,矿工需要解决一个数学难题,即找到一个数字n,n与交易数据哈希值的组合满足特定条件。这个条件是:n与交易数据哈希值的组合的哈希值要小于比特币网络设定的目标值。

2、 以太坊算法

以太坊采用Ethah算法,这是一种基于内存计算的工作量证明算法。与比特币的SHA-256算法相比,Ethah算法对内存要求略高,这挖矿设备需要配备大量的内存。以太坊体系中,矿工需要解决一个数学难题,即找到一个数字n,n与交易数据哈希值的组合满足特定条件。

三、挖矿的计算

1、 硬件计算

挖矿的计算主要依赖于硬件设备。比特币加密货币的挖矿主要依赖于ASIC(专用集成电路)矿机。ASIC矿机采用定制化的硬件设计,能够以极高的效率进行计算。GPU(图形处理器)和CPU(处理器)用于挖矿,但效率较低。

2、 软件计算

挖矿的软件计算主要依赖于挖矿软件。挖矿软件负责将挖矿任务分配给硬件设备,并收集计算。市面上有多种挖矿软件,如BFGMiner、CGMiner。这些软件支持多种算法,能够满足不同加密货币的挖矿需求。

四、挖矿的意义

1、 维护网络安全

挖矿是维护加密货币网络安全的重要手段。解决复杂的数学问题,矿工们确保了区块链的不篡改性。挖矿过程中产生的算力有助于抵御恶意攻击,保障网络稳定运行。

2、 促进技术创新

挖矿推动了计算机硬件和软件技术的不断创新。为了提高挖矿效率,矿工们不断研发高性能的硬件设备和挖矿软件。这些创新成果应用于加密货币领域,还辐射到其他领域,如人工智能、大数据。

挖矿是一种神秘的算法,它计算机硬件和软件的协同工作,解决复杂的数学问题,生成新的加密货币。尽管挖矿过程充满挑战,但它维护网络安全、促进技术创新方面具有重要意义。加密货币市场的不断发展,挖矿将继续发挥其独特的作用。

版权说明:本文章来源于网络信息 ,不作为本网站提供的投资理财建议或其他任何类型的建议。 投资有风险,入市须谨慎。

本分分类: 交易所费率对比

版权声明:本文由用户上传发布,不代表虚拟货币币价今日行情分析 | 数字货币交易所费率对比 - 币研社立场,转载联系作者并注明出处https://www.bg1225.cn/532.html

相关文章